Analysis

Netherlands recorded 0.0024 units per US$ of GDP for reserve position in the imf, us dollar, per unit of gdp in 2025.

That represents a change of up 2.7% on the previous year and down 7.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, reserve position in the imf, us dollar, per unit of gdp in Netherlands peaked at 0.0167 units per US$ of GDP in 1966 and was at its lowest, 0.0006 units per US$ of GDP, in 2007.

Netherlands ranks 40th of 189 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ated

Reserve position in the IMF, US dollar divided by GDP (current US$),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.

Reserve position in the IMF, US dollar ÷ GDP (current US$)
